陶瓷/金属钎焊用钎料及其钎焊工艺进展

摘    要:阐述了陶瓷/金属钎焊用不同温度的活性钎料及以降低焊缝残余应力为中心的钎焊工艺进展;指出:在我国耐高温、抗氧化性优良的高温耐热型活性钎料是重点发展方向;介绍了降低焊缝残余应力的钎焊工艺和焊缝中间添加过渡层的选择原则。

关 键 词:活性钎料  钎焊工艺  陶瓷/金属钎焊

Progress of Filler Metals and Brazing Processes for Ceramic to Metal Brazing

Abstract:In the present paper the progress was reviewed in the active filler metals with different temperatures for ceramic to metal brazing and related brazing technique of reducing joining-gap residual stress.It was recommended that the key developing field for our country should be the high temperature active filler with heat-and oxidation-resisting properties.The brazing techniques to reduce joining-gap residual stress and the principles to select transition layers for the joining gap were also introduced.
Keywords:Ceramic brazing  Active filler metal  Brazing process  Progress
